
La Voluta
Languedoc, Hautes Corbières, France
La Voluta was born in 2014, following Anna Rubio and Jean-Benoît Vivequain's trip around the world, where they were inspired by diverse winemakers who shared their knowledge and experiences. The couple met in New Zealand while WWOOFing, produced their first vintage there, then settled in Cucugnan beneath Quéribus Castle in the Hautes Corbières. On their 6.5 hectares in the wild, rugged hills between Cucugnan and Maury, they observe and question each intervention for its necessity and impact on the living. Their work is artisanal and as manual as possible — patient and simple — to preserve grape qualities. Inspired by the Koru (Māori symbol of new life), La Voluta strives for vins vivants, sains, et libres — living, healthy, and free wines. Each cuvée is made only once, never repeated.

La Voluta Kuntur
2024 · Still · White · 12.5%
Muscat Marselan
Kuntur is one of La Voluta's whites, a Muscat-Marselan blend from Anna Rubio and Jean-Benoît Vivequain's 6.5-hectare organic estate in Cucugnan, under the ruins of Quéribus Castle in the Hautes Corbières. Marselan (a Cabernet Sauvignon × Grenache cross developed in 1961) is unusual as a white-style component; the pair's house principle is that each cuvée is made only once and never repeated, which licenses experiments like this. Hand harvest, whole-cluster fermentation, short maceration of 3 to 5 days, native yeasts only, no added sulphur at any stage. 12.5% alcohol; expect aromatic Muscat lift balanced by Marselan's quieter structural backbone, the whole pulled into salinity by the Hautes Corbières limestone substrate.

La Voluta Tembo
2023 · Still · Red · 13.5%
Grenache Carignan
Tembo is La Voluta's Grenache-Carignan red, the canonical Hautes Corbières pairing brought into Anna Rubio and Jean-Benoît Vivequain's strict natural-wine register. The pair farm 6.5 hectares organically in Cucugnan under the ruins of Quéribus Castle. Cellar protocol holds: hand harvest, whole-cluster fermentation, short maceration of 3 to 5 days, native yeasts only, no added sulphur at any stage. The house principle is that each cuvée is made only once and never repeated, so the Tembo bottling will not return in the same form. 13.5% alcohol; expect the southern-Languedoc weight that Grenache and Carignan naturally provide, lifted by Voluta's short-maceration cellar approach and the limestone substrate that defines the Hautes Corbières hills.

La Voluta Karaka
2022 · Still · Red · 14%
Grenache
Anna Rubio and Jean-Benoît Vivequain met in New Zealand learning winemaking and now run La Voluta on 6.5 hectares of organic-farmed vines in Cucugnan, in the Hautes Corbières under the ruins of Quéribus Castle. The cellar is uncompromising: each cuvée is made only once and never repeated, hand-harvested grapes are whole-cluster fermented for short macerations of 3 to 5 days, native yeasts only, and no sulphites are added at any stage. Karaka is the cellar's Grenache bottling. The 14% alcohol on the 2022 release is in line with what old Grenache vines deliver in the Hautes Corbières limestone hills; expect a dark-fruited, savoury, peppery Grenache with the Voluta cellar's signature lift rather than weight.
